Grass clippings : 2-3 inches: Thicker layers tend to compact and rot, becoming quite slimy and smelly. Use a 3-inch layer of the composted grass clippings around garden plants, taking care not to allow the mulch to come in contact with trunks, stems or stalks. Dried grass clippings mixed with two times as much dried leaf litter will create compost with a healthy balance of nutrients and will break down quickly due to the correct carbon to nitrogen ratio.
